Update on the Ja Morant Injury & the Rest of the Report
After missing the series’ second game with right hand soreness, Grizzlies superstar Ja Morant was able to suit up in Game 3. While he may have still felt some soreness, you couldn’t tell by the stat line: Morant compiled 45 points, 13 assists and 9 rebounds in 41.5 minutes of action. Perhaps more importantly, Morant dropped 22 straight points in the 4th quarter, spurring on an ill-fated Grizzlies comeback attempt.
It is expected that Morant will be in the starting lineup Monday, and he will likely play a crucial role in any sort of comeback effort by the Grizzlies. However, there are some other question marks for the Grizzlies in Game 4: Dillon Brooks was ejected from the game a few seconds into the second half after punching LeBron James in the groin. Whether he is suspended further remains to be seen.
Here is a full list of players with injury concerns heading into Monday:
- Memphis Grizzlies: Ja Morant (hand, probable), Steven Adams (knee, out), Jake LaRavia (calf, doubtful)
- Los Angeles Lakers: Anthony Davis (foot, probable), LeBron James (foot, probable), Dennis Schroder (achilles, probable)
Memphis Grizzlies vs. Los Angeles Lakers Game 4 Predictions
Our top Grizzlies vs. Lakers best bet is for the Lakers to continue their dominance and extend the series lead to three games in Game 4. Oddsmakers seem to agree with this Grizzlies vs. Lakers best bet prediction, with the Lakers currently positioned as 4.5-point favorites with -190 money line odds.
The Lakers have been one of the NBA’s top offensive units, ranking 10th in the league in field goal percentage, 8th in total field goals, 2nd in total free throws made, and 6th in points scored. They’ve also been solid defensively, corralling the second-most defensive rebounds in the league and holding opponents to the second-worst three-point percentage in the NBA.
However, the Grizzlies have been just fine on both sides of the ball in 2023 as well: they rank in the top-ten in the NBA in field goals, shot attempts, offensive rebounds, defensive rebounds, assists, steals, blocks, and points. Still, the Grizzlies are running into trouble not as a result of a skill discrepancy; instead, it has been the individual matchups that have cursed Memphis.
Both teams like to play on the inside, ranking in the top ten in two-point shots made. Still, with Steven Adams out, the Grizzlies are in a bad shape in the paint. The only remaining starting big man is Jarren Jackson Jr., and though he’s been very good this season (18.6 PPG, 6.8 RPG, and a league-leading 3.0 BPG), the 6’11” power forward/center might be on his own to defend LeBron James and Anthony Davis.
One of the greatest one-two punches in the history of the NBA, the Grizzlies are going to need to gameplan around stopping James and Davis, likely at the cost of open perimeter shooters. If the Grizzlies don’t have an answer for LeBron and AD, they can be looking at a really long night – and, even if they do, we don’t think things will go much better. Player Prop Picks & Grizzlies vs. Lakers Best Bets for 4/24 Featuring Desmond Bane & Rui Hachimura
There are a few players who are a part of our Grizzlies vs. Lakers best bets regarding player props even before all the lines have been released. The first of these is Grizzlies guard Desmond Bane’s total points prop. The over provides solid value sitting at 20.5 with -130 odds. Bane has averaged 21.5 PPG this season, scoring 22, 17, and 18 points in his three games this series. Expect Bane to play a key role in the offense with the Lakers’ defense focused on stopping Ja Morant.
Finally, we love Rui Hachimura’s total points prop. Though Hachimura only averaged 11.2 PPG in 2023, he has been a man on fire in the playoffs so far. Through three playoff appearances, Hachimura has tallied 29, 20, and 16 points. This is no aberration, either: Hachimura averages over 17 PPG in eight playoff appearances in his career.
We expect Hachimura to remain a key component of the Lakers’ offensive attack, easily surpassing his total points prop if it is set where we expect it to be (closer to his regular season PPG average than his postseason mark).
